問題タブ [overlays]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
google-maps - すべてのマーカー オーバーレイがマーカーと重なるのを防ぐことはできません google maps api v3
API バージョン 3 を使用した Google マップがあります。カスタム アイコンと番号付きラベルを使用してマーカーを作成したいと考えています。私はこれに最も受け入れられていると思われる方法、以下に提供する「labels.js」ソリューションを使用しようとしています。ただし、何を試しても、すべての番号付きオーバーレイがすべてのマーカーと重なっています (マーカーとラベルを同じ zIndex に設定しているにもかかわらず)。私が話していることを確認するには、提供されたスクリーンショットを参照してください。画面のマーカー 14 と 15 を見ると、15 のラベルが 14 のマーカーと重なっていることがわかりますが、そうではなく、14 のマーカーの下にあるはずです。
http://i.imgur.com/QoYqcHJ.jpg
カスタム オーバーレイとの適切なオーバーラップに関する多くの議論は、次のコード行を中心に展開されます。
しかし、私はこれを用意しています。各ラベル オーバーレイとマーカーのペアを同じ zIndex に設定しています。適切にオーバーラップしているマーカーは、この zIndex の増分が機能していることを証明しています。以下にすべてのコードを提供しましたが、レンガの壁にぶつかりました。私は運がない限り、可能な限りすべてを試しました。すべての変数が適切に宣言されていると仮定します。
label.js:
マーカー付きの地図を作成するコード:
android - ズーム時にビットマップのサイズを大きくする
マップ上のビットマップの描画を処理するクラスがありますが、ズームアウトすると画像が大きくなり、近づくと小さくなるという問題があります。近づくと大きくなり、離れると小さくなるという、正反対のことをしたいのです。
私は絵画クラスのオブジェクトを置きます:
ios - Flowplayer Flash オーバーレイ機能と iOS 互換性
Flowplayer フラッシュの問題があります。複数のビデオ オーバーレイを使用していますが、プレーヤーは複数のデスクトップ ブラウザーで完全に動作しますが、iOS デバイスでは動作しません。iPad js インクルードと .ipad() を試しました。しかし、何も機能しません。誰かがここの欠陥を指摘できますか、またはこれを iOS デバイスで再生するための回避策を教えてください。これが完全なコードです...ありがとう!
google-maps-api-3 - 円のオーバーレイをクリックして座標を取得する
クリックしてマップの座標を取得するスクリプトがあります。同時に、マップ全体に広がる円のオーバーレイがあります。オーバーレイで覆われた領域以外の座標を取得できます。この問題の適切な回避策は何ですか?
openlayers - openlayersでオーバーレイレイヤーの選択を無効にしますか?
オーバーレイレイヤーを選択できないようにする方法を知っている人はいますか? 外部ソースのベースマップを使用しており、表示する必要がある (そしてユーザーが非表示にできるようにする) (ポリゴン) kml レイヤーを追加しましたが、ポイントやラインではなくそのレイヤーを選択させたくありません。その上にあります。